Contemporary sleep research and systematic reviews indicate that individuals with congenital or early blindness can experience visual and visuo-spatial imagery in their dreams, challenging older assumptions about oneiric content in the blind.

The analysis

The retrieved literature, specifically recent systematic reviews and empirical analyses of dream banks, consistently supports the finding that blind individuals retain or develop the capacity for visual and visuo-spatial imagery during dreaming. While color-blind individuals naturally perceive colors (often through altered trichromatic mechanisms) and therefore dream in color, the more debated question regarding congenitally blind individuals is also supported by recent neuroscientific consensus indicating visual dream content. None of the papers refute the claim.

Katarina Ilić, Rita Bertani, Neda Lapteva, Panagis Drakatos, Alessio Delogu, Kausar Raheel, Matthew Soteriou, Carlotta Mutti, Joerg Steier, David W. Carmichael, Peter J. Goadsby, Adam Ockelford, Ivana Rosenzweig. Visuo-spatial imagery in dreams of congenitally and early blind: a systematic review. 2023. https://doi.org/10.3389/fnint.2023.1204129

This systematic review concludes that congenitally and early blind individuals can experience visuo-spatial impressions and visual imagery in their dreams.

Jung‐Woo Kang, Rita Bertani, Kausar Raheel, Matthew Soteriou, Jan Rosenzweig, Antonio Valentı́n, Peter J. Goadsby, Masoud Tahmasian, Rosalyn Moran, Katarina Ilić, Adam Ockelford, Ivana Rosenzweig. Mental Imagery in Dreams of Congenitally Blind People. 2023. https://doi.org/10.3390/brainsci13101394

Analysis of dream logs from congenitally blind subjects demonstrates the presence of visual imagery in their mentation alongside heightened non-visual sensations.

Vitali H, Campus C, De Giorgis V, Signorini S, Gori M. The vision of dreams: from ontogeny to dream engineering in blindness.. 2022. https://doi.org/10.5664/jcsm.10026

Reviewing neuroscientific studies on blindness and dreaming, the authors note that congenitally blind individuals maintain the capacity to produce visual dreams through multisensory integration and top-down or bottom-up mechanisms.
